Superconductivity in systems with a low particle density

A regular procedure for going over from the Fermi picture to the Bose picture of elementary excitations is proposed for Fermi systems with a low density of charge carriers. The residual interaction between bosons can be taken into account. The possibility of describing a low-density system in the mean-field approximation is analyzed. Systems which are equivalent from the standpoint of the mean-field approach may differ substantially in the strength of the residual interactions and thus in the nature of the transition to the condensed state. When a system contains localized impurity states, the interaction of the carriers with impurities can be described through renormalization of the binding energy of the two-particle state. This energy is increased by virtual transitions of particles from the band to impurity levels. 10 refs., 1 fig
